What Is an Intelligent Hybrid Solar Inverter?
If your electricity bill keeps increasing despite installing solar panels, you're not alone. Many homeowners assume solar panels alone are enough to reduce electricity costs. In reality, the inverter you choose plays an equally important role. That's where an intelligent hybrid solar inverter makes the difference. It intelligently controls electricity from:
- Solar panels
- Battery storage
- Utility grid
Unlike conventional inverters that simply provide backup during power outages, a hybrid inverter continuously monitors energy production and consumption to determine the most efficient source of power at any given time.
This intelligent energy management is what makes hybrid solar inverters a cost-saving solution for modern homes.
How Does a Hybrid Solar Inverter Reduce Electricity Bills?
1. Prioritizes Free Solar Energy
One of the biggest advantages of a hybrid solar inverter is that it uses solar power as the primary energy source whenever sunlight is available.
Instead of relying on expensive grid electricity during the day, your home consumes the electricity generated by your solar panels first. This significantly reduces your monthly electricity consumption from the grid.
2. Stores Excess Solar Power for Later Use
Many homes produce more solar electricity than they consume during the daytime.
Rather than letting this energy go to waste, a hybrid solar inverter stores the excess electricity in batteries. This stored energy can then be used:
- During the evening
- At night
- During power outages
- During periods of high electricity demand
This maximizes the utilization of every unit of solar energy generated.
3. Reduces Dependence on Grid Power
Electricity purchased from the utility grid contributes directly to your monthly bill.
An intelligent hybrid inverter minimizes grid dependency by automatically switching between:
- Solar power
- Battery power
- Grid electricity
This intelligent switching happens without manual intervention, ensuring optimal energy efficiency.

Tips to Maximize Savings with a Hybrid Solar Inverter
For getting the best results from your hybrid solar inverter:
- Choose the correct inverter capacity based on your home's power requirement.
- Install high-quality solar panels.
- Use energy-efficient appliances.
- Schedule high-power appliances during daylight hours whenever possible.
- Regularly monitor your energy consumption through the inverter's smart monitoring system.
- Ensure professional installation and periodic system inspection.
Following these practices can further improve energy efficiency and maximize savings.

Can a hybrid inverter work without batteries?
Yes, many hybrid inverters can operate without batteries using solar power and the utility grid. However, batteries are required for power backup during outages and for storing excess solar energy.
